Has been a starter at defensive end . . . is a very hard-playing, physical player . . . brings a good attitude, effort and hustle to the defense.

2007: Started all 11 games . . . tallied 41 tackles, including one tackle for a loss, and two fumble recoveries . . . had six tackles, all solo, against Presbyterian . . . tallied four tackles at Tennessee-Martin . . . had nine tackles, including one tackle for a loss, against Tennessee State.

2006: Saw action in all 11 games . . . tallied 20 tackles, including 15 solo tackles . . . recorded two sacks and one blocked kick . . . had a career-high eight tackles at Georgia Tech . . . blocked a kick at Southeast Missouri . . . had two tackles against Austin Peay, Eastern Kentucky, Murray State, Tennessee State and Jacksonville State.

2005: Saw action in one game, registering one tackle against Edward Waters.

Previous College: Transferred to Samford after one year at the University of Alabama.

High School: Named first-team All-State at Straughn High School . . . two-time captain and four-time All-County selection.

Personal: Born Oct. 18, 1985 . . . son of Tony and Donna Nall . . . majoring in interior design.
